> I released v0.2 of GWT Beans Binding (JSR 295) port:
>
>  Change log for v0.2
> ================================
>
>  - ListBoxAdapterProvider added (not working)
>  - BeanPropertyDescriptorGenerator updated to support
> PropertyDescriptor.getPropertyType()
>  - HasPropertyChangeSupport interface added. This interface should be
> implemented
>    by all POJOs that will participate in bindings
>  - GWTx upgrade: custom patch that adds support for
> PropertyDescriptor.getPropertyType()
>  - ObservableCollections port fixed
